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Dias Sanches

Limitar quantidade de imagens na pagina

Recommended Posts

Boa noite,

 

Estou ha alguns dias tentanto limitar o número de imagens que aparece em umas das paginas, más não estou tendo sucesso.

 

Você podem me ajudar

 

Vejam meu código.

 

<%
Data=request.queryString("Data")
Classe=request.queryString("Classe")
foto=request.queryString("foto")
Produto=request.queryString("Produto")
Valor=request.QueryString("Valor")
Set Conn= server.createobject("adodb.connection")
DSNtest = "Provider=Microsoft.Jet.OLEDB.4.0;Data Source=" & Server.Mappath("../dados/dados.mdb")
Conn.Open DSNtest

Set rs = Server.CreateObject("ADODB.Recordset")
sql = "SELECT * FROM produtos WHERE  Classe='Athelier'ORDER BY id asc"
'"SELECT * from xp order by id asc"
rs.Open SQL, conn, 3
%>

                    <%
Do While NOT rs.EOF
   If cont=0 Then
   Response.Write "<tr>"
     End If
   Response.Write "<td>"
   %>
                    <table width="160" border="0" cellspacing="0" cellpadding="0">
                          <tr>
                            <td align="center" valign="middle"><a href="produto.asp?id=<%=rs("id")%>"><img src="<%=rs("foto")%>" alt="<%=rs("Produto")%>" width="152" height="152" border="0" style="border: 2px solid #EBD7D0; padding: 5px; "/></a></td>
                          </tr>
                          <tr>
                            <td height="25" align="center" valign="middle" class="Verdana-12-743C31-Normal"><%=rs("Produto")%> <br />
                              <span class="Verdana-12-verm-titulo-Bold">R$ <%=rs("Valor")%> </span></td>
                          </tr>
                          <tr>
                            <td height="15" align="center" valign="middle" class="Verdana-12-743C31-Normal"></td>
                          </tr>
                        </table>                        
                        <%
Response.Write "</td>"
cont=cont+1
If cont=4 Then ' Definimos a Quantidade de colunas
If Cont > 7 Then exit do 'Determina a quantidade de imagens expostas
     Response.Write "</tr>"
  cont=0
  End If
 rs.MoveNext
 Loop 
 %>

Compartilhar este post


Link para o post
Compartilhar em outros sites

você pode usar uma gallery image, e você pode limitar atraves dela, ou tb colocando dentro do loop para exibicao apenas 3 imagens

Compartilhar este post


Link para o post
Compartilhar em outros sites

Boa tarde pessoal,

 

Não tive sucesso ainda...

 

Creio que estou me confundindo neste campo do código.

 

<%
Response.Write "</td>"
cont=cont+1
If cont=4 Then ' Definimos a Quantidade de colunas
If Cont > 7 Then exit do 'Determina a quantidade de imagens expostas
     Response.Write "</tr>"
  cont=0
  End If
 rs.MoveNext
 Loop 
%>

Esta acontecendo o seguinte se deixo

If Cont > 7 Then exit do 'Determina a quantidade de imagens expostas
com
If Cont > 3
ele fica certinho porém aparece apenas uma linha com as quatro colunas determinadas. Quando deixo daquela forma anterior >7 ele aparece todos os itens cadastrados ele não para no 7 ou no 8

Compartilhar este post


Link para o post
Compartilhar em outros sites

Bom dia,

 

xanburzum e jonathandj

 

Realmente estou confuso normalmente eu utilizo uma galeria com CSS e funciona normalmente sem a legenda, mas se add a legenda ela se distorce, por isso que resolvi trabalhar com esse codigo, porque coloco os textos dentro de uma tabela e não tenho risco de distorcer.

 

Eu consegui determinar o número de colunas, eu queria que decesse até duas linhas por isso pensei em limitar as imagens mais não estou tendo sucesso.

 

Por favor me dêem uma luz

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.